Showtime Launches International Television Sales with 'Fat Actress'

[via press release from Showtime]

Showtime Launches International Television Sales With 'FAT ACTRESS'

LOS ANGELES, Sept. 22 -- Showtime Networks Inc. will be attending MIPCOM 2004 with Tony Lynn, Sr. Vice President, Program Distribution, bringing to market the most talked-about, new comedy series FAT ACTRESS, starring two-time Emmy(R)-winner Kirstie Alley. Created by Brenda Hampton and Kirstie Alley, FAT ACTRESS is a seven-episode, half-hour hybrid comedy/reality series that was inspired by Alley's real life. Tom Bull serves as supervising producer.

"Kirstie Alley has starred in two sitcoms, CHEERS and VERONICA'S CLOSET, that were both extremely popular in international television markets. She is a popular personality, well-known for her quick and acerbic wit. I think FAT ACTRESS will be a breakaway hit for Showtime and our international clients," said Lynn.

Taking her life experiences and recreating them in the extreme, Alley plays a fictional version of herself -- a successful television and movie star whose weight gain has become the subject of every tabloid imaginable as well as the bane of her existence as she tries to find work and true love in an unforgiving Hollywood. This irreverent series, which will be co-created and executive produced by Alley and Brenda Hampton ("Seventh Heaven"), will be unscripted, with each episode emanating from a story outline and the actors largely improvising the dialogue. FAT ACTRESS will begin production September 20 in Los Angeles and will premiere March 6, 2005. Sandy Chanley ("Curb Your Enthusiasm") also executive produces through her production company, Production Partners, Inc.

Bravely willing to lampoon her image that has been mercilessly ridiculed by the tabloids over the past few years, Alley will give us a glimpse of the humor and the irony in her battle to lose weight and get back on television in a tough business that prefers the once-svelte version of the Emmy(R) Award- winning star of "Cheers." Stories will be drawn from a heightened perception of her real-life experiences, and some of Alley's friends have promised to appear as themselves in guest cameos to further blur the lines between truth and fiction. Anyone struggling with issues about weight or self-esteem -- or just looking for love and happiness -- will identify with Alley's life.

Brenda Hampton, co-creator of the series, created and currently executive produces "Seventh Heaven," the smash hit drama that has been running for eight years on The WB. While known primarily for this family drama, Hampton has actually spent most of her career writing and producing several successful sitcoms such as "Mad About You," "The John Larroquette Show" and "Blossom."

Kirstie Alley became a household name playing "Rebecca Howe" on the hit television series "Cheers" for which she won both a Golden Globe(R) and an Emmy(R) Award. Her flair for comedy translated to the big screen in movies like Woody Allen's "Deconstructing Harry," "Look Who's Talking" and "Look Who's Talking Too." In 1997, Alley returned to television to produce and star in the sitcom "Veronica's Closet," which ran for three seasons.
